Background Intraoperative vessel visualization is highly desirable, especially when the target is related to or close tomain vessels, such as in the skull base and vascular surgery. Contrast-enhanced ultrasound (CEUS) is an imaging technique that allows visualization of tissue perfusion and vascularization through the infusion of purely intravascular ultrasound contrast agents (UCA). Methods After cerebral scanning with B-mode ultrasound (US) CEUS is performed, UCA are injected and insonated with low mechanical index US. A UCA-specific harmonic signal is transduced using a contrast-specific algorithm to obtain real-time angiosonography (ASG). Conclusions Real-time intraoperative ASG is a rapid, reliable, repeatable method for vessel visualization and evaluation of tissue perfusion.
